Details
A vulnerability was found in Google Chrome (Web Browser). It has been classified as critical. Affected is some unknown processing. The manipulation with an unknown input leads to a information disclosure vulnerability. CWE is classifying the issue as CWE-200. The product exposes sensitive information to an actor that is not explicitly authorized to have access to that information. This is going to have an impact on confidentiality, integrity, and availability. CVE summarizes:
Google Chrome before 4.1.249.1036 does not have the expected behavior for attempts to delete Web SQL Databases and clear the Strict Transport Security (STS) state, which has unspecified impact and attack vectors.
The weakness was presented 04/01/2010 (Website). The advisory is shared for download at googlechromereleases.blogspot.com. This vulnerability is traded as CVE-2010-1230 since 04/01/2010. The exploitability is told to be easy. It is possible to launch the attack remotely. The exploitation doesn't require any form of authentication. There are neither technical details nor an exploit publicly available. The MITRE ATT&CK project declares the attack technique as T1592.
The vulnerability scanner Nessus provides a plugin with the ID 45086 (Google Chrome < 4.1.249.1036 Multiple Vulnerabilities), which helps to determine the existence of the flaw in a target environment. It is assigned to the family Windows. The commercial vulnerability scanner Qualys is able to test this issue with plugin 117083 (Google Chrome Code Execution and Security Bypass Vulnerabilities).
Upgrading to version 4.0.263.0 eliminates this vulnerability. The upgrade is hosted for download at chrome.google.com.
